What is a Matte Makeup Look?

A matte makeup look leaves your face with a matte appearance and takes away all of the sheen and gloss. This not only effectively conceals facial flaws but also gives you a very royal appearance. For oily skin types, this look works best because it can reduce the oily appearance while still blending in like a soft powdery look. The fact that one seems so natural in this is another aspect of this appearance that appeals to us.

The following advice can help you quickly create matte makeup looks, which are more on the natural side.

  • Prep your skin − Start with a clean, moisturized face to create a smooth base for your makeup.

  • Use a matte primer − A matte primer will help to control oil and create a matte finish for your makeup.

  • Choose a matte foundation − Look for a foundation with a matte finish to create an even, matte base for the rest of your makeup.

  • Apply powder − Use a matte powder to set your foundation and keep oil at bay throughout the day.

  • Use matte eyeshadows − Opt for matte eyeshadows instead of shimmery ones to create a more matte overall look.

  • Use a matte blush − Choose a matte blush to add color to your cheeks without adding any extra shine.

  • Finish with a matte lipstick − Use a matte lipstick in a shade that complements your overall makeup look to complete your matte makeup look.

Remember to use these tips in moderation to avoid a flat, dull look. A matte makeup look can be a great way to create a polished, sophisticated look for any occasion.

Step by Step Guide for Matte Makeup Look

Following are the major steps −

Step 1

Face cleansing and moisturizing. Make sure your face is clean and moisturized before you begin applying makeup. By properly moisturizing your face, you can make sure that your makeup stays on and looks even. Use a mild cleanser and some lukewarm water to wash your face. Avoid exfoliating or scrubbing your skin. Just apply the cleanser with your fingertip and rinse it off with water.

The moisturizer you choose should be suitable for your skin type. For instance, if you have oily, acne-prone skin, pick a non-comedogenic moisturizer that is oil-free. Use an anti-aging moisturizer that contains petrolatum and antioxidants if you have fine lines and/or wrinkles to help lessen their appearance.

Step 2

Think about exfoliating. Exfoliating your skin might help you get a matte finish and minimize oil on your face. But be aware that over-exfoliating can irritate your skin. Wet your face with some lukewarm water before applying an exfoliating cleanser and massaging it into your skin in circular motions.

As these areas are prone to getting more oil than others, you might want to take particular care to your nose, forehead, and chin. Be sure to stay away from your eyes and the area around them. Exfoliating cleanser should be thoroughly rinsed off with water.

Step 3

Use toner. Toner is a wonderful approach to get a matte finish because it can balance out your skin's PH level and lessen oil production. Toner should be applied to your skin with a cotton ball. Before applying moisturizer, let the toner completely dry.

Step 4

Use primer. Moreover, makeup primer can ensure that your makeup will stay in place and some primers may even offer other advantages. For instance, you may select a primer that will give you a matte finish or one that would make your pores look smaller. Blend the primer in well after applying it all over your face.

Step 5

Spread your base evenly. The foundation application comes next. You can apply your regular foundation, a BB cream, or a foundation with a unique matte consistency. Make sure the hue complements your skin tone and choose one that enhances the appearance of your skin. To apply foundation, you can use a cosmetic brush or blending sponge. Make sure you evenly blend it across your entire face.

Step 6

Don't forget to conceal and accentuate the region under your eyes. Apply some concealer immediately after applying the highlighter under your eyes. Before applying the concealer, make sure the highlighter is thoroughly blended. And thoroughly blend the concealer. Concealer can also be used on other parts of your face that could use a bit more coverage. Use a small amount of concealer and blend, for instance, if you wish to cover a blemish.

Step 7

Apply setting powder with a sweep. Applying a layer of setting powder will finish off your foundation appearance. Choose a hue that will give your skin a matte finish, then evenly mix it over your entire face. Your skin should appear even and shine-free once you're done. You may also use a foundation that is loose powder.

Step 8

Put a neutral shade on your crease and lids. Using a matter-neutral colour to your lids and crease will help you achieve a matte finish for your eyes. Apply a light brown or beige colour in a few layers with a small, fluffy brush. Only a few shades should be added to the hue to make it darker than your natural skin tone. Choose a hue that doesn't appear dazzling or sparkly. Choose a hue that appears matte in the palette. To further draw attention to your eyes, you can optionally sweep a little of this shade along your lower lash line.

Step 9

Put on some matte lipstick. Next, pick a soft, matte lipstick hue to give your lips some colour. Choose a neutral, pink, or earthy tone. After applying lipstick to your lips, squeeze them together to spread the colour. In order to stop lipstick from bleeding, you can also line your lips with a complementary lip pencil.
